Soil body curing agent and rotary spraying anchor pile construction process applying soil body curing agent
The invention discloses a soil body curing agent and a rotary spraying anchor pile construction process applying the soil body curing agent, and relates to the technical field of anchor pile construction. The soil body curing agent is prepared from the following raw materials in percentage by weight: 40-60% of cement, 20-35% of desulfurization gypsum, 10-20% of slag powder, 0.01-1% of a water reducing agent and 0.01-5% of a sulphoaluminate exciting agent, wherein P.O.42.5 cement or P.O.52.5 cement is adopted as the cement. Compared with common cement, the soil body curing agent can reduce the construction cost, improve the strength and the anchoring effect of an anchor pile, realize waste recycling and facilitate solving the pollution problem. The invention further provides a construction process of a selective spraying anchor pile. According to the invention, by using the soil body curing agent, the construction cost is effectively reduced, the strength and the anchoring effect of the anchor pile are improved, pollution is reduced, waste recycling is achieved, and good economic benefits are achieved.
